Aguado, Chicago Finalize $18,000,000 Contract
Saturday, February 3rd , 2063
Chicago and Jose Aguado have reached an agreement bringing the 30-year-old right fielder to the Eclipse for 3 years.
Aguado reportedly signed a deal worth $18,000,000, although the financials were not disclosed to the media.
All-time Aguado has played in 1093 games, batted .242 with 236 home runs and 849 base hits.

San Francisco Earthquakes Head Scout Timmo Brown Hoping for New Contract
Saturday, February 3rd , 2063
Saying he thinks the table is set for the San Francisco Earthquakes to have a long run of success, longtime head scout Timmo Brown is hoping to stay on board with the club.
"While we haven't come to a new contract agreement for the coming year, I am really hoping that we can," Brown said. "This organization is really well run and I believe with the prospects coming up in the system we are on the cusp of a lot of success."

A Breath of Fresh Air: John Lindberg Hired as Cabo San Lucas general manager
Tuesday, January 30th , 2063
When Cabo San Lucas made wholesale changes in the front office after last season, fans were left wondering in which direction their favorite club would head. The hiring of John Lindberg simply led to more questions.
"I'm the new kid on the block. I know that I've got a lot to prove to you," conceded Lindberg. "When you take over a ballclub, you don't have an offseason. There are signings, trades, meetings, arbitration, drafting the right young players. It's a year-round job. There's a lot of positives here. We're going to try to build on those and field the best team we can."
